黑狐家游戏

负载均衡技术解析,设备转发的本质与系统容错机制,负载均衡 技术

欧气 1 0

(全文约1280字)

负载均衡技术的核心认知误区 在云计算架构领域,"设备转发导致错误"这一说法折射出对负载均衡技术的本质理解偏差,负载均衡(Load Balancing)并非指设备主动制造错误,而是通过智能流量调度实现系统资源的高效利用,其核心在于建立多节点间的动态协作机制,而非简单的错误转发处理,现代负载均衡系统实质是分布式流量管理中枢,其技术架构包含流量识别、路径计算、健康监测、动态调整四大核心模块。

负载均衡设备的功能架构解析

负载均衡技术解析,设备转发的本质与系统容错机制,负载均衡 技术

图片来源于网络,如有侵权联系删除

  1. 流量识别层 负载均衡设备部署在L4-L7网络层级,具备深度包检测(DPI)能力,通过分析TCP握手报文、HTTP头信息等12-15层协议特征,建立包含业务类型(Web/SQL/Video)、连接状态(长连接/短连接)、数据特征(JSON/XML)等18个维度的流量画像,例如Nginx的流表(Stream Table)可同时跟踪200+并发连接的会话状态。

  2. 路径计算引擎 采用混合算法架构实现智能调度:

  • 矩阵运算:基于节点负载系数(Current/Max)、网络延迟(RTT±15%阈值)、服务可用性(健康检查结果)构建3×3决策矩阵
  • 机器学习:训练时序预测模型(ARIMA/LSTM)预判未来30分钟负载趋势
  • 动态权重:实时调整节点权重系数(0.2-0.8区间),如AWS ALB的Active Health Tracking机制

容错机制设计 建立四重保障体系:

  • 健康检查协议:HTTP/HTTPS/SSL/TCP多协议支持,包含302重定向检测、204无内容检查等12种异常识别
  • 故障隔离:采用VLAN+MAC地址绑定实现物理隔离,单节点故障不影响其他实例
  • 冲突解决:基于CRDT(冲突-free 轻量级复制原语)的会话保持机制,确保用户会话连续性
  • 恢复策略:分级熔断机制(50%→80%→100%流量阈值),配合指数退避算法(base 2,max 32次)

典型场景对比分析

传统硬件负载均衡(如F5 BIG-IP)

  • 硬件加速特性:支持1.2Tbps线速处理,但存在固件升级窗口期
  • 协议支持:深度集成HTTP/2(多路复用)、QUIC(0-RTT)等新协议
  • 容错案例:某银行核心系统采用双机热备,RTO<30秒,RPO=0

软件定义负载均衡(如Kubernetes Ingress)

  • 容器化部署:通过Sidecar模式实现服务网格集成
  • 智能路由:基于Service网格的Service-to-Service通信(mTLS加密)
  • 动态扩缩容:配合HPA(Horizontal Pod Autoscaler)实现分钟级弹性调整

云服务负载均衡(如AWS ELB)

  • 零接触部署:自动检测EC2实例健康状态
  • 安全增强:支持TLS 1.3、WAF防护(200+规则库)
  • 成本优化:按请求计费模式(0.09美元/百万请求)

技术演进与前沿实践

智能调度算法突破

  • 强化学习应用:Google的BERT-LS算法将调度准确率提升23%
  • 数字孪生技术:构建虚拟集群镜像,预演扩容方案
  • 边缘计算融合:CDN节点与边缘负载均衡器协同工作,P99延迟降低40%

新型架构实践

  • 微服务网格:Istio的Service Mesh实现服务间智能路由
  • 无状态架构:Netflix的Hystrix熔断器配合Sentinel实现分布式限流
  • 量子负载均衡:IBM量子处理器在特定场景下实现指数级优化

安全增强机制

  • 零信任架构:持续验证节点身份(mTLS+SPIFFE)
  • DDoS防御:基于AI的流量异常检测(误报率<0.01%)
  • 数据加密:全链路量子密钥分发(QKD)技术试点

典型应用案例分析

电商大促场景 某头部电商平台采用"三层混合架构":

负载均衡技术解析,设备转发的本质与系统容错机制,负载均衡 技术

图片来源于网络,如有侵权联系删除

  • 前置层:全球CDN节点(AWS CloudFront+阿里云CDN)
  • 中间层:云服务商负载均衡(Azure Load Balancer)
  • 后置层:自建Kubernetes集群(2000+Pod规模) 通过动态流量切分,实现秒杀期间5000QPS的平稳处理,故障恢复时间缩短至3分钟。

金融交易系统 证券交易系统采用"双活+多活"架构:

  • 主备集群异地部署(北京-上海)
  • 交易路由基于地理位置(GPS定位精度亚米级)
  • 交易状态实时同步(Raft协议) 系统可用性达99.999%,单日处理交易量突破200亿笔。

工业物联网 智能制造平台应用:

  • 工业协议网关(OPC UA/MQTT)
  • 边缘计算节点负载均衡
  • 数字孪生仿真平台 实现产线设备利用率提升35%,预测性维护准确率92%。

技术发展趋势展望

自适应架构演进

  • 自我描述性配置(Self-Descriptive Configuration)
  • 自组织网络(SON)集成
  • 自愈系统(Self-Healing)实现

能效优化方向

  • 硬件能效比(PUE)优化至1.15以下
  • 节点休眠机制(动态功耗管理)
  • 碳足迹追踪(区块链存证)

标准化进程

  • IETF RFC 9235(QUIC负载均衡)
  • CNCF服务网格标准(2025年)
  • 5G核心网负载均衡规范(3GPP TS 23.501)

常见误区澄清

设备转发≠错误处理

  • 设备转发是基础功能(如Nginx的worker进程)
  • 错误处理属于应用层功能(如业务异常捕获)
  • 现代负载均衡设备通过健康检查实现错误隔离

负载均衡≠集群调度

  • 负载均衡关注流量分配(QoS)
  • 集群调度关注任务分配(CPU/Memory)
  • 两者通过Service网格实现协同(如Istio的ServiceEntry)

硬件设备≠必须选择

  • 软件方案成本降低70%(Kubernetes+云服务)
  • 混合架构(硬件+软件)成为主流(阿里云SLB+K8s)
  • 2023年全球软件负载均衡市场规模达47亿美元(Gartner)

负载均衡技术本质是构建弹性、智能、安全的分布式流量管理体系,其核心价值在于通过精细化调度实现资源利用率最大化(通常提升40-60%),同时建立容错机制保障系统可靠性(SLA可达99.9999%),随着数字孪生、量子计算等技术的融合,负载均衡正在从传统的流量分发向智能决策中心演进,成为云原生架构的关键基础设施,理解其技术本质,有助于企业构建高可用、低成本的现代化IT系统。

标签: #负载均衡技术是说发错误的是设备转发的吗

黑狐家游戏
  • 评论列表

留言评论